Output 0100f7ae6bfaffe422986f4be54b77a2051b3ed4c4126eee3eb18f8c4d3f2753:1

value
307243699
script pubkey
OP_0 OP_PUSHBYTES_20 26db23a9b98e33bef038688d0397ae441c32c2e1
address
tb1qymdj82de3cemaupcdzxs89awgswr9shpvkwkeu
transaction
0100f7ae6bfaffe422986f4be54b77a2051b3ed4c4126eee3eb18f8c4d3f2753